    POKER IS BACK !! SBR Spring Poker Event 2018

    SBR Spring Poker Event 2018

    The top 100 SBR Poker tournament players in points won will advance to the Poker Championship on Saturday March 31st at 5PM ET.

    Qualifier Schedule
    Three daily tournaments Mon-Fri beginning January 29 through March 28 – 3PM, 8PM, 11PM ET.

    50 players per tournament. 6-point entry fee for Non-Pros, SBR Pros Play Free. View structure.

    The $2,000 in cash prizes will be paid in bitcoin. Monday April 2nd SBR will send payment to the winners through bitcoin. The exchange rate used will be the price SBR paid to acquire the Bitcoin that same morning.

    Terms and Conditions
    1. Must be an SBR Pro by March 1st to receive poker championship password.
    2. Participants are limited to one account per household. Players who operate multiple accounts or are otherwise restricted from the forum during the qualification period may lose their eligibility at the discretion of SBR.
    3. In the event that there are ties for the 100th spot, tiebreaker will be # of Cashes. If still tied, the earlier SBR Forum join date.
    4. Player may participate in one daily qualifier tournament per day. No shows will be ejected after 15 minutes.
